Love of Self and Others Begin With God
Because God is LOVE and the source of all there is, there is nothing that is created independently of Him. Love manifests outwardly in our lives when we diligently seek a personal relationship with God and begin to do the inner work needed to understand who God is and what love looks like in action. Then we can learn how to love ourselves and others the way God does. The following poems give a glimpse into agape, self and eros love based on my personal experiences:
